The Power of Skepticism and Critical ThinkingThe Power of Skepticism and Critical Thinking is a new 3-hour online continuing education (CE/CEU) course that examines how positive skepticism and critical thinking are necessary in clinical practice.

The history of health care abounds with treatments that persisted (although they didn’t work) for many years without ever being seriously challenged. How did this happen? More to the point, how is it that this continues to happen today? At least a part of the answer can be found in a very long list of cognitive errors, fallacies, and biases that seem to be part of human nature. Human beings are endowed with the ability to reason and the need to find connections between things and events. The problem is that we have such a strong need to find connections that we sometimes see them even when they are not there. In health care, arriving at the wrong conclusion can be an error of life and death proportions.

This course defines and illustrates the many ways in which health professionals can fall prey to one or more thinking errors that can result in mistaken diagnoses, clinical errors, and reduced therapeutic success. Also reviewed are the powerful influences of propaganda, quackery, and pseudoscience. The antidote to thinking errors and pseudoscience is adherence to the sound principles of positive skepticism and critical thinking in clinical practice. This course offers the opportunity to uncover one’s own biases and learn new strategies and techniques for applying critical thinking skills. Included are how-to lists for evaluating new treatments, conference speakers, published studies, and internet content. Course #31-14 | 2019 | 56 pages | 20 posttest questions
